About Weight & Mass
Weight and mass measure how much matter an object contains. While technically different (mass is constant, weight depends on gravity), the terms are often used interchangeably in everyday life. The kilogram is the only SI base unit still defined by a physical artifact until 2019, when it was redefined using the Planck constant.

How to convert Pound to Ounce?
To convert Pound (lb) to Ounce (oz), multiply the value by the conversion factor. 1 lb = 16 oz. Example: 5 lb = 80 oz.
